Developers / How to set MPV as default player for LMCE
« on: April 09, 2016, 03:46:04 pm »
Hi Folks

I posted a while back about some of my mp4 videos not playing correctly to the MD under this topic

I decided to test the same video's out on my laptop running 64 bit Of Ubuntu 14.04 LTS.

Open the video  under the normal Ubuntu player  and it played as expected,  installed xine player,  open the same file and got 6 seconds of audio before dying... same thing happens when playing on LMCE MD.

Done research and installed VLC player, libdvdcss2, and every other decoder available to Ubuntu still no joy.

Video plays audio for 6 seconds, skip a head the video plays but then freezes.

Certain videos play fine and load instantly with the  same result with LMCE 14.4.

Read this topic today it seems MPV is new mplayer.

This mpv player along with Ubuntu's build in player and VLC play the videos.

So my question is, how hard is it to set either of the above players  as LMCE default player, removing xine from the system.

Or am taken a trip down the wrong lane?

I look forward to your response's


Users / Adding a NTFS hard drive under 1404
« on: March 07, 2016, 01:55:56 pm »
Hi Folks

Instead of opening  another topic I am going to post here as I have the same problem.

Just installed 14.4 the latests snap shot and ran a sudo update.

Plugged in my USB 4TB Seagate  Expansion Desk  external hard drive with all my media,  and the LMCE didn't ask to added it to the system.

Instead I had to mount it to /home/public/date/videos/dvd (dvd is a new folder I created )

sudo mount /dev/sdb2 /home/public/data/videos/dvds

The drive works prefect in 10.4 and LMCE picks the device up with out any issues.

As you can see from the out put of lsblk, the device is there

sda      8:0    0 465.8G  0 disk
|-sda1   8:1    0 461.9G  0 part /
|-sda2   8:2    0     1K  0 part
`-sda5   8:5    0   3.9G  0 part [SWAP]
sdb      8:16   0   3.7T  0 disk
|-sdb1   8:17   0   128M  0 part
`-sdb2   8:18   0   3.7T  0 part /home/public/data/videos/dvds
sr0     11:0    1  1024M  0 rom 

Here's a link to  paste bin with the out put of  my system specs


anyone know how to remove the blue,yellow,red box at the top right corner of the screen, it sits there while play a video


Users / lmce-md-meta packages have unmet dependencies
« on: January 24, 2016, 12:35:50 pm »
Hi folks

I edited the  /usr/pluto/bin/ and enable "raspbian_armhf"  LMCE 14.4

Ran /usr/pluto/bin/ and ended up with the following error

The following packages have unmet dependencies:
 lmce-md-meta : Depends: pluto-avwizard (>= but it is not going to be installed
                Depends: pluto-avwizard (< but it is not going to be installed
E: Unable to correct problems, you have held broken packages.
/usr/pluto/bin/ line 170: /tmp/TeeMyOutputExitCode_3193: No such file or directory

Does this effect the Raspberry Pi2 setup and how do you fix such error


Users / lmce-media-identifier upgrade error
« on: January 24, 2016, 11:50:19 am »
Hi Folks

Just ran an upgrade on 14.4 and lmce-media-identifier is giving the following error

dpkg: error processing archive /var/cache/apt/archives/lmce-media-identifier_2. (--unpack):
 trying to overwrite '/usr/pluto/bin/External_Media_Identifier', which is also in package id-my-disc 1.8.ub1004
dpkg-deb: error: subprocess paste was killed by signal (Broken pipe)
Errors were encountered while processing:
E: Sub-process /usr/bin/dpkg returned an error code (1)

Fix for me was to

sudo apt-get remove --purge id-my-disc

sudo apt-get remove --purge lmce-media-identifier

sudo apt-get install lmce-media-identifier

Tried to re-install id-my-disc

get this error

dpkg: error processing archive /var/cache/apt/archives/id-my-disc_1.8.ub1004_i386.deb (--unpack):
 trying to overwrite '/usr/pluto/bin/External_Media_Identifier', which is also in package lmce-media-identifier
dpkg-deb: error: subprocess paste was killed by signal (Broken pipe)
Errors were encountered while processing:
E: Sub-process /usr/bin/dpkg returned an error code (1)

There seems to be a conflict of packages .


Users / Device died when selecting radio station
« on: December 21, 2015, 02:35:12 pm »
Hi Folks

when selecting a radio station system does a reload every time a station is selected

Looking at the DCERouter.log it shows the below error.

Return code: 134
3   12/21/15 13:30:06   DCERouter (server)   Device died... count=3/200 dev=DCERouter
Mon Dec 21 13:30:06 GMT 2015 died

any ideas

LMCE 14.4


Users / Has anyone tried this
« on: December 08, 2015, 01:39:02 pm »
Looking at buying one of these to use as MD

What are your taught's

thanks in advance


Hi All
I started a little project for DansGuardian back several weeks ago to allow editing of configuration files such banned site list, exception ip list, etc.

I am looking for some testers and suggestion from the community.

The basic functions of the module is to allow editing of the configuration files without having to SSH into Linuxmce console.

The layout of the module is as followed.

A new folder called dansguardian is created inside the lmce-admin folder.

Inside of this folder contains several PHP scripts folders & two .sh files and one exported mysql  file.

On the initial setup the main index.php file checks the database to see if we have a database called dansgaurdian, If the database doesn’t exist, it will create it, and then import the exported mysql file.

Next, it checks to see if there is any IP address belonging to the MD’s in the pluto_main/ Device table and if there is any IP address, then export and import them into dansguardian/ exceptioniplist.

This check allows our entire MD’S to have full access to the internet.

The android app is just a font end to the module and allows you to easy  add and edit blocked/exceptional  ips and websites,  also  any changes made to the scripts in the back end, the app is updated on the next re-opening.

If you’re interested in testing or have any suggestion then follow the below.

You a can also see screen shots and video clips here

**Please note, I can't be held responsible if this back your system**.

I have  tested this on my live machine of 10.4 and it should work with 8 & 12 system, but I haven't tested it on 8.10 system.

Sudo commands maybe different on different systems.

To get started follow these instructions.
*** You must have DansGuardian & Squid3(transparent)installed first ***

Before we start, lets create a back up
SSH into your LMCE
mkdir /etc/dansguardianBACKUP
cp -r /etc/dansguardian/* /etc/dansguardianBACKUP
Check to see  if the backup is OK
cd /etc/dansguardianBACKUP
type dir  you should the files and folder then
continue to install below

1.   SSH into your LMCE
2.   chown your username -R /var/www/lmce-admin
3.   cd /var/www/lmce-admin/
4.   wget
5.   tar -xzf dansguardian.tar
6.   Check to see if the folder was extracted and created type dir
7.   you will see a folder called dansguardian in the lmce-admin folder.
8.   Type cd
9.   To ensure the folder and files is writable type
10.   chown your username -R /var/www/lmce-admin/dansguardian/
11.   type cd
12.   The Below command copies the scripts to enable and disable filtering
13.   cp /var/www/lmce-admin/dansguardian/setupfiles/*.sh /usr/pluto/bin/
14.   visit OR  http://dcerouter/lmce-admin/dansguardian/
15.   You should get all systems good to go if the install went correctly
16.   Download the android app from here

Warning Note:
if you are testing the filter by categories do not enable the categories that have a red warning.

If you have installed the blacklist correctly you will have a green tick against the each category.
This green tick tells you are good to enable.

If you enable a red warning dansguardian won't restart  and all internet will be down and you will have to edit the file manually and then  remove the all of the categories that were  enabled.

I use nano you may be using VI

nano /etc/dansguardian/lists/bannedsitelist

scroll down to the to the categories list  and crtl + k to cut the text  (ie nano) crtl + o to save and crtl+x to exit

restart Dans
/etc/init.d/dansguardian start or /etc/init.d/dansguardian reload

Then revisit filter by categories in the drop down menu. disable all and update Dans Guardian, other wise every time you update the file, it will hang the system because the database was not told to disable the category, and you will have to repeat the above steps.

You can see it in action by disabling the filter  and watching the log using this command  tail -f /var/log/squid3/access.log

Once disabled the log does not move or update.

any issues let me know in real time or in this topic.


Developers / PHP to execute sudo command
« on: August 24, 2015, 10:38:21 pm »
Hi Folks

Working on a little project for dansguardian and squid3, mostly dansguardian,  but have ran into a problem,  is there away for PHP to execute sudo command.

I need to execute  /etc/init.d/dansguardian restart using PHP, I have seen the command in some php files in lmce-admin, but I just  can't get it to work. do I need to include some files belonging to LMCE?

Once I get pass this part my project will rolling, here is a quick video of what I have achieved so far

I have made some changes since this video..etc added in a delete button to remove blocked sites.

Any help would be great,

Installation issues / Firewall issues (was: Volume levels drop on MD)
« on: July 19, 2015, 01:48:44 pm »
Just going to jump on the back of my topic.

FIREWALL is not posting to mysql, when I added a new port forward it does not save.

Please advise.

Kind regards
LMCE 12.4

Installation issues / Volume levels drop on MD
« on: July 15, 2015, 11:29:57 pm »
Hi folks

Don't know if this is an bug, but every time I power on my MD  I have to increase the volume through ssh

So its clear, my MD'S work with with 8.10 prefect I am currently running 12.4.

I also don't want to come across a moan, but I am testing and reporting issues back to that we can all benefit.

As every one's hard ware is different.

The volume was increase on the initial setup under Av wizard  to 100%, but every time I boot up the MD the volume is low and I have to ssh into MD and up it.

let me know  if there is a command I can run to report the issue in more detail.



Installation issues / Issue with 12.4 video play back of mp4
« on: July 12, 2015, 03:39:32 pm »
Hi folks

the  issue,

Xine keeps crashing on certain play back of MP4 video files, the same video files played on 8.10, and play back was prefect.

LMCE install snapshot

LMCE­ 1204­ 20150630070­030841.iso   30­ Jun­ 2015   2.2Gb

( sudo upgrade completed after install )

The core is  Intel Corporation 4th Gen Core Processor DRAM Controller (rev 06)

The MD
Intel Corporation Mobile 945GM/PM/GMS, 943/940GML and 945GT Express (due to be replaced)

It freezes during play back of 1 or 2 minutes and I have to kill the process.

see paste bin here ,   look for video name 17 again

after freezing no other video will play from the library, quick reload allows me to choose different video file, but only audio plays.

Stop it and choose the same file again and I get both audio and video play back.

please advise

Installation issues / Owncloud loses LMCE configuration.
« on: July 11, 2015, 09:02:30 pm »
Hi Folks

Just installed 12.4 on my brand new PC, 8.10 wouldn't run on my new machine.

Decided to install owncloud and it worked no problem, but it has lost all the LMCE configurations, it looks nothing like the screen shots  on .

The CSS style is gone and there is no links to LMCE storage.

Checking the system version. it has installed 8.1 of owncloud the latest release.

Is this a big problem for me, No, but I am pretty sure this isn't good for the work done by ochorocho (please correct me if I have the wrong name.)

The last time I install 12.4 in the early stages, owncloud looked pretty cool, I loved the way it looked like the LMCE forum.

This maybe something worth looking into.


Just want to post this here future reference hope LMCE team don't mind, and for any one looking for transparent proxy the below works, I have it working on Linuxmce 10.4

remember I  am not responsible  if your machine breaks. but again I just want some were to future reference.

I respect the fact that squid in been worked on for the new up coming releases. as per
and well done to the dev's.

Here'ss my quick notes to get it working  (some wording is taken from &  )

Thank's to these wiki pages they helped a lot

sudo apt-get install squid3
edit squid3 config 
nano /etc/squid3/squid.conf
http_port 3128 to http_port 3128 transparent
Find the "acl localhost src" line and insert the following line below: "acl dcerouterlocalnet src"
Under the line is one that reads "http_access allow localhost". Below this you need to insert a line allowing your local LAN; "http_access allow dcerouterlocalnet. Now save the file, and exit.

apt-get install dansguardian
nano /etc/dansguardian/dansguardian.conf
change filter port to  8081 and proxyip =

/etc/init.d/apache2 restart
/etc/init.d/dansguardian stop
/etc/init.d/dansguardian start
sudo /etc/init.d/squid3 restart

Edit file /usr/pluto/bin/ from terminal

nano /usr/pluto/bin/ OR  vi /usr/pluto/bin/

NOTE: check ifconfig to figure out what lan card has static address  eht0 or eth1  change the eth in the forward port rule to match lan card of static ip address from LMCE .ie

Add the below line  in just under the heading # Set some default firewall parameters before opening ports

iptables -A PREROUTING -t nat -i eth0 -p tcp --dport 80 -j REDIRECT --to-port 8081

Then close and save  and reboot the system, visit to check if proxy is working.

The normal firewall forwarding rule would not work even if  you enable it, so my work around was to setup upon booting the core.

Install proxy graph to view the hits and page catches, follow the following link.

Create cronjob under root  to update chart 

crontab -e

Add the following line

*/5 * * * * cd /etc/init.d/squid-graph && ./squid-graph --tcp-only -n -o=/var/www/squid-graph/ --title="Give your report a title " < /var/log/squid3/access.log

CD into /etc/init.d/squid-graph and edit the file  nano squid-graph to add auto refresh to the html report for every 6 minutes

Locate the below line
print IDX "<H1>$title</H1>\n";

And add the below line under it

print IDX "<meta http-equiv=\"refresh\" content=\"360\" \n";

Installation issues / error
« on: April 11, 2015, 04:26:39 pm »
Hi folks

may need to address the below error
Fatal error: Call-time pass-by-reference has been removed in /home/lmcecomp/public_html/wp-content/plugins/google-analytics-dashboard/gad-admin-options.php on line 272


